Welcome

Download and scan with CCleaner.
1. Starting with v1.27.260, CCleaner started installing the Yahoo Toolbar as an option which IS checkmarked by default during the installation.
IF you do NOT want it, REMOVE the checkmark when provided with the option OR download the 'No Toolbar' 'Slim' version instead of the 'Standard Build'.

2. Before first use, select Options > Advanced and UNCHECK "Only delete files in Windows Temp folder older than 48 hours"

3. Then select the items you wish to clean up.

In the Windows Tab:
* Clean all entries in the "Internet Explorer" section except Cookies.
* Clean all the entries in the "Windows Explorer" section.
* Clean all entries in the "System" section.
* Clean all entries in the "Advanced" section.
* Clean any others that you choose.

In the Applications Tab:
* Clean all except cookies in the Firefox/Mozilla section if you use it.
* Clean all in the Opera section if you use it.
* Clean Sun Java in the Internet Section.
* Clean any others that you choose.

4. Click the "Run Cleaner" button.
5. A pop up box will appear advising this process will permanently delete files from your system.
6. Click "OK" and it will scan and clean your system.

* Now click on the 'Registry' tab/button on the left.
* Then click on the 'Scan for issues' button at the bottom.
* If CCleaner displays any issues,click on 'Fix selected issues'.
* You'll then be asked 'Do you want to backup changes to the registry',you must click 'YES'.
* Save the backup somewhere safe,your desktop is a good a place as any.
* Then click 'Fix Issues',then click 'Close'.
* Exit CCleaner.

Viewpoint Manager is considered as foistware instead of malware since it is installed without users approval but doesn't spy or do anything "bad".
Read this article:
http://www.clickz.com/news/article.php/3561546
You are well advised to remove the program now.
Go to Start > Settings > Control Panel > Add/Remove Programs and remove the following programs if present,then restart your pc:
Viewpoint
Viewpoint Toolbar
Viewpoint Manager
Viewpoint Media Player

Your version of Sun Java is out of date.
Older versions have vulnerabilities that malware can use to infect your system.
Follow these steps to remove older versions of Sun Java,and then update.
1. Download the latest version of Java Runtime Environment (JRE)
2. Scroll down to where it says 'Java Runtime Environment (JRE) 6u10'.
3. Click the "Download" button to the right.
4. Select the Platform and Language for your download,then check the box that says: "Accept License Agreement".
5. The page will refresh.
6. Click on the link to download 'Windows Offline Installation, Multi-language - jre-6u10-windows-i586-p.exe' [15.52 MB] and save to your desktop.
7. Close any programs you may have running - especially your web browser.
8. Go to Start > Control Panel double-click on Add/Remove programs and remove all older versions of Java.
9. Check any item with Java Runtime Environment (JRE or J2SE) in the name.
10. Click the Change/Remove button.
11. Repeat as many times as necessary to remove each Java version.
12. Reboot your computer once all Java components are removed.
13. Then from your desktop double-click on jre-6u10-windows-i586-p.exe to install the newest version.
